The U.S. Biodegradable Packaging Market is projected to experience significant growth in the coming years due to increasing consumer awareness about environmental conservation and sustainable packaging practices. The market is driven by a shift towards eco-friendly packaging solutions and regulations promoting the use of biodegradable materials. The market is expected to witness a rise in demand from industries such as food and beverage, cosmetics, and healthcare.
Two major growth drivers for the U.S. Biodegradable Packaging Market include the growing emphasis on reducing plastic waste and the rise in consumer preference for sustainable packaging options. Additionally, advancements in biodegradable materials technology and increased investment in research and development are also contributing to market growth.
On the other hand, two industry restraints for the market include the higher cost of biodegradable packaging compared to traditional options and the lack of standardization in regulations governing biodegradable materials. These factors could hinder market growth to some extent in the forecast period.
Segment Analysis:
The U.S. Biodegradable Packaging Market can be segmented based on type, end-use industry, and region. By type, the market includes biodegradable plastics, paper-based packaging, and others. In terms of end-use industry, the market caters to segments such as food and beverage, personal care and cosmetics, pharmaceuticals, and others. Geographically, the market is divided into regions such as the West, Midwest, South, and Northeast.
Competitive Landscape:
The U.S. Biodegradable Packaging Market is highly competitive with several key players actively involved in product development and strategic partnerships to gain a competitive edge. Some of the prominent players in the market include Amcor Limited, Mondi Group, Tetra Pak International S.A., WestRock Company, and Smurfit Kappa Group. These companies are focusing on expanding their product portfolios and enhancing their distribution networks to capitalize on the growing demand for biodegradable packaging solutions.
